You have the set (0,5) (2,7) (3,11) (7,4) (10,5). If you added (2,1) to the set, why would it no longer be a function?

Respuesta :

CodyWohlfeil
CodyWohlfeil CodyWohlfeil
  • 02-04-2020

Answer:

No, it would no longer be function.

Step-by-step explanation:

Because then there would be two different y values for the x value 2.
